Lunchtime Talk

A lunchtime talk By Keith Johnston of the Scarborough Historical and Archaeological Association about the Bombardment of Scarborough by German battlecruisers on 16 December 16 1914; a preliminary to the opening of the Remember Scarborough exhibition at Scarborough Art Gallery the following day.

About this site

Scarborough 1914-18 is currently a work in progress as we build a range of content related to Scarborough, Whitby and Filey, and the surrounding areas on during the Great War of 1914-18.
